Mass Notification Systems Market: Overview

The mass notification system market is primarily a platform that is used to communicate information to a large group of people. Its unique feature is to provide correct information to the right people in times of crisis. Times of crisis may be natural disasters, extreme weather conditions, public safety crises, and many other events that may impact an organization and its stakeholders. It helps in effectively responding to the emergency with optimized operations and performance.

Mass Notification Systems Market: Dynamics

Growth Drivers

What factors are accelerating the expansion of the Mass Notification Systems market?

Digitization across industries is a primary growth driver, as it introduces the advantages of security and safety through IP-enabled devices. This has led to extensive implementation of IP-based notification systems, particularly in the education and healthcare sectors. The ability to manage notifications via a single web-based console that tracks and controls processes across multiple communication networks and channels further supports market expansion.

Increasing safety and security concerns for people and organizations continue to elevate demand. These systems enable rapid, accurate communication during crises, helping organizations respond effectively and maintain optimized operations and performance.

Restraints

What factors are limiting the growth of the Mass Notification Systems market?

Concerns related to the sensitive nature of data handled by these systems can restrain adoption, especially in organizations prioritizing strict data control. The need for reliable underlying infrastructure and integration with existing communication channels may also present barriers in certain environments.

In some cases, the complexity of deploying and maintaining multi-channel systems across diverse organizational sizes can moderate the pace of implementation, particularly for smaller entities with limited technical resources.

Mass Notification Systems Market: Segmentation

The mass notification systems market is segmented by components, deployment, organization size, application, verticals, and region.

Based on Components, the mass notification systems market is bifurcated into solutions and services. Solutions hold market leadership in the mass notification systems market. The solution segment is further divided into distributed recipient solutions, wide-area solutions, and In-building solutions. Moreover, the service segment can further be bifurcated into Managed Services and Professional Services.

By  Deployment, the mass notification systems market is divided into cloud-based and on-premises. The on-premises segment held a share of over 65 % in 2023. The mass notification systems market can be deployed using either cloud-based or on-premises mode. On-premises deployment mode accounts for a larger market share. As the name suggests, on-premises requires the installation of the system on the premises of the organization. It is considered to be the most trustworthy mode of deployment considering the sensitive nature of the data. The turnaround time for operations is significantly reduced in emergencies in this deployment mode.

Based on Organization Size Segment, the mass notification systems market is divided into large enterprises and small and medium-sized enterprises. Large Enterprises account for a substantial portion of demand because of their complex communication needs, multi-location operations, and greater capacity to invest in comprehensive notification platforms. This segment helps drive market scale through high-value deployments.

Based on Application Segment, the mass notification systems market is divided into emergency response, business continuity and management, and public warnings and alerting. Emergency Response is a core application that enables rapid dissemination of critical information during crises. Business Continuity and Management supports organizational resilience by maintaining communication and operational coordination, while Public Warnings and Alerting addresses broader community and public safety needs.

Mass Notification Systems Market: Regional Analysis

Why will North America continue to dominate the global market during the projection period?

North America is expected to hold the largest market share of the mass notification systems market. The high usage of devices such as mobile phones, laptops, tablets, and many more is contributing to the growth of the mass notification systems market in the North American region. The awareness of the optimized usability of resources is considerably high in the region, which translates into the understanding of the need for adopting mass notification systems.

The Asia Pacific is expected to be growing significantly in the mass notification systems market. The developing region has invested in the technology sector due to the increasing demand, which makes it easier to adopt mass notification systems. People also are being conscious of the safety facilities being provided to them. As the economy is rising, there are a lot of government-supported policies that focus on public safety. These may act as a catalyst for the growth of mass notification systems in the region.
